Why are Cheek Implants Performed?
- Enhance Cheek Volume
As we age or due to genetics, the cheeks may lose volume and begin to sag, creating a hollow or sunken appearance. Cheek implants can restore youthful fullness to the cheeks, giving the face a more lifted and vibrant look. - Facial Balance & Harmony
Cheek implants help improve facial symmetry and balance by adding volume to the cheeks, which can create a more proportionate and aesthetically pleasing face. This is particularly beneficial for individuals with a flat or recessed mid-face. - Feminine Aesthetic
Cheek implants are commonly sought by individuals undergoing
facial feminization surgery (FFS), as they can add a softer, more feminine contour to the face. By enhancing the cheeks, the procedure creates a more rounded and youthful appearance. - Restore Facial Contours
As people age, the cheeks often lose their definition, which can result in a sagging or tired appearance. Cheek implants restore youthful contours to the face, improving the overall aesthetics and rejuvenating the look of the face.
Benefits of Cheek Implants
- Permanent Results: Unlike injectable fillers, which require repeated treatments, cheek implants provide a permanent solution for restoring facial volume.
- Natural-Looking Enhancement: Cheek implants are custom-shaped to fit your facial anatomy, ensuring that the results look natural and blend seamlessly with your other facial features.
- Improved Facial Symmetry: By enhancing the cheeks, implants can create a more balanced and harmonious appearance, especially if the cheeks were previously flat or underdeveloped.
- Youthful Appearance: Cheek implants can rejuvenate the face by adding volume to the cheeks, restoring a fuller, more youthful look.
- Minimal Maintenance: Once cheek implants are placed, they require little to no maintenance and provide long-lasting results.
What to Expect During the Procedure
Cheek implant surgery is typically performed under general anesthesia and takes about 1 to 2 hours, depending on the complexity of the procedure. Here's what to expect during the procedure:
Key Steps of the Cheek Implants Procedure:
- Consultation & Planning
During your consultation, the surgeon will assess your facial structure, discuss your aesthetic goals, and determine the ideal implant size and shape. The surgeon will also explain the procedure, risks, and expected results. - Incision Placement
Cheek implants are typically placed through small incisions inside the mouth or under the eyelid (transconjunctival approach). These incisions are strategically placed to minimize visible scarring. - Implant Placement
The surgeon will create a small pocket in the cheek area and place the implant carefully in the correct position. The implant is then secured in place, and the surrounding tissues are sutured to ensure the implant stays in position. - Closure & Dressing
After the implant is in place, the incisions are closed with fine sutures. A dressing may be applied to help reduce swelling and support healing. In some cases, a small compression garment may be used around the cheek area.
Recovery & Aftercare
The recovery process after cheek implant surgery is relatively straightforward, though some care is required to ensure optimal results. Here’s what to expect during recovery:
- Recovery Time: Most patients can return to light activities within 1 to 2 weeks. Swelling and bruising around the cheeks and eyes are common and usually subside within 2 to 3 weeks. Full recovery can take 6 to 8 weeks, as the implant settles into place.
- Swelling & Bruising: Mild swelling and bruising are normal after cheek implant surgery. These symptoms typically subside within 1 to 2 weeks, although some residual swelling may last for several weeks.
- Discomfort: Mild discomfort or tightness in the treated area is normal, but pain can usually be managed with prescribed medications.
- Post-Treatment Care: You will need to avoid strenuous activities and heavy lifting for about 4 to 6 weeks to allow the cheeks to heal properly. You will also need to follow oral care instructions if the incisions are inside the mouth.
- Follow-Up Appointments: Follow-up visits will be scheduled to monitor healing, remove stitches (if necessary), and ensure that the implants are properly placed and healing well.
Cost of Cheek Implants in Korea
The cost of cheek implant surgery in Korea varies depending on the surgeon’s experience, the clinic’s reputation, and the complexity of the procedure. On average, the cost for cheek implant surgery ranges from:
- Cheek Implants Surgery: ₩2,500,000 – ₩5,500,000 KRW (Approx. $2,000 – $4,400 USD)
- Consultation Fee: ₩50,000 – ₩100,000 KRW (Approx. $40 – $80 USD)
- Post-Surgery Care & Follow-Up: Additional costs may apply depending on medications, follow-up visits, and post-surgical garments.
